A Corporate event is more than just gathering; it is a powerful opportunities for businesses to strengthen their brand, build professional relationships, and showcase their achievements. Whether you are organizing an annual gala, a product launch, a high-stakes investor meeting, or a large-scale business conference, the choice of venue plays a crucial role in determining the success of your event.
A well-chosen venue does more than provide a space for attendees—it sets the tone for the event and influences how guests perceive your brand. A luxurious hotel ballroom, for example, exudes elegance and professionalism, making it ideal for formal award ceremonies or executive meetings. Meanwhile, a high-tech convention center offers cutting-edge facilities and ample space, catering to large-scale conferences and product showcases. For a more intimate and engaging experience, a boutique venue or an unconventional space—such as an art gallery or rooftop garden—can add a unique touch that resonates with guests.
Beyond aesthetics, the right venue ensures a seamless and well-organized event. Factors such as location, accessibility, and on-site amenities contribute to the overall experience. A venue that is centrally located, offers ample parking, and provides state-of-the-art audiovisual equipment will enhance guest convenience and make event execution smoother. Additionally, in-house catering, customizable seating arrangements, and breakout spaces can further enhance the flow of activities and facilitate networking opportunities.
No matter the size or nature of your corporate event, selecting the right venue is a strategic decision that can elevate the entire experience. Below, we explore seven spectacular corporate event venues that combine functionality, style, and a memorable ambiance to take your event to the next level.
1. Luxury Hotel Conference Centers
When it comes to convenience and top-notch service, luxury hotel conference centers are a prime choice for corporate events. These venues provide everything needed for a successful gathering, from state-of-the-art conference rooms to dedicated event planning teams. With their ability to accommodate both small executive meetings and large-scale conferences, luxury hotels like The Ritz-Carlton, Four Seasons, and JW Marriott stand out for their impeccable service, elegant décor, and modern amenities.
One of the biggest advantages of hosting a corporate event at a luxury hotel is the availability of accommodation for out-of-town guests. Your attendees can enjoy a comfortable stay, reducing the hassle of traveling between the venue and their lodging. Additionally, most hotels offer catering services, allowing you to customize menus and provide high-quality meals without the need for external vendors. Another key benefit is the presence of on-site technical support, ensuring that presentations, video conferencing, and other digital aspects of the event run smoothly. Whether you’re organizing a leadership summit or a networking session, a luxury hotel conference center provides an all-in-one solution for a seamless event experience.
2. Historic Mansions and Estates
For those seeking a venue with charm, character, and timeless elegance, historic mansions and estates are an excellent option. These venues are steeped in history, offering breathtaking architecture, opulent interiors, and picturesque gardens. Events hosted in such settings exude sophistication and exclusivity, making them perfect for executive retreats, black-tie galas, and award ceremonies.
Imagine hosting your corporate event in a grand estate like The Biltmore in North Carolina, Oheka Castle in New York, or The Breakers in Rhode Island. The ambiance of these locations adds a sense of prestige and refinement that is hard to match. Guests can marvel at intricate woodwork, chandeliers, and classic ballrooms while enjoying gourmet dining and top-tier service. Additionally, historic mansions often provide private grounds that can be transformed into outdoor networking spaces, cocktail receptions, or breakout sessions. The exclusivity of these venues enhances the sense of importance surrounding your event, making it a memorable experience for all attendees.
3. High-Tech Conference Centers
In today’s fast-paced digital world, technology plays an integral role in corporate events. High-tech conference centers cater to companies that require advanced audiovisual setups, fast internet connectivity, and seamless integration of virtual and in-person participation. These venues are designed to support hybrid events, making them ideal for businesses with global teams and remote attendees.
Notable high-tech conference centers include The Moscone Center in San Francisco, McCormick Place in Chicago, and ExCeL London. These locations offer large auditoriums equipped with the latest technology, such as video walls, interactive displays, and automated lighting systems. Attendees can benefit from real-time data sharing, video conferencing, and immersive presentations that elevate engagement levels. Another key advantage of high-tech venues is their ability to accommodate large audiences while ensuring smooth logistical operations. Whether it’s a global business summit or a tech product launch, a high-tech conference center provides the infrastructure needed for a successful event.
4. Rooftop Venues with Skyline Views
Few venues can rival the breathtaking appeal of a rooftop setting overlooking a vibrant city skyline. Rooftop venues are becoming increasingly popular for corporate events due to their modern, stylish, and open-air ambiance. These spaces provide a refreshing alternative to traditional conference rooms, making them perfect for networking events, cocktail receptions, and exclusive brand launches.
Venues like The Press Lounge in New York, London’s Skylight at Tobacco Dock, and the 360 Chicago Observation Deck offer unparalleled views that add an extra layer of sophistication to any event. Guests can sip cocktails while watching the sunset, creating a relaxed yet upscale environment for business discussions and social interactions. Rooftop venues often come with stylish lounge seating, customizable lighting options, and entertainment facilities, ensuring a memorable experience. Additionally, these spaces allow for creative branding opportunities, such as custom LED displays or branded décor elements. If you want to impress your guests while providing an unforgettable setting, a rooftop venue with a stunning skyline view is the way to go.
5. Art Galleries and Museums
For a venue that blends culture, creativity, and elegance, hosting a corporate event in an art gallery or museum is a fantastic choice. These locations offer a unique and inspiring atmosphere, surrounded by world-renowned art pieces, historical artifacts, and beautifully curated exhibitions. Art galleries and museums provide a sense of sophistication while encouraging engaging conversations among attendees.
Prestigious museum venues like The Louvre in Paris, The Metropolitan Museum of Art in New York, and The Getty Center in Los Angeles offer stunning event spaces that can be tailored to fit corporate needs. Imagine hosting a corporate dinner in a grand hall surrounded by timeless masterpieces, or a product launch in a contemporary gallery with minimalist aesthetics. The artistic setting enhances the event’s appeal, making it more memorable and thought-provoking. Additionally, many museums offer private guided tours as part of the event experience, providing guests with an enriching cultural engagement. If your company values innovation, creativity, and elegance, an art gallery or museum venue can create a truly distinguished corporate event.
6. Waterfront Venues and Yacht Clubs
For a corporate event that combines luxury with relaxation, waterfront venues and yacht clubs provide the perfect backdrop. With stunning water views, serene surroundings, and upscale interiors, these venues offer a tranquil yet sophisticated environment for business gatherings.
Waterfront locations like The Marina Bay Sands in Singapore, The Wharf in Washington, D.C., and The Pacific Yacht Club in Vancouver provide exclusive event spaces with breathtaking views of the sea, rivers, or lakes. These venues are ideal for executive meetings, VIP receptions, and high-end corporate retreats. Hosting an event at a yacht club adds an element of exclusivity, where guests can enjoy private boat tours, fine dining, and an atmosphere of leisure. Whether it’s a sunset networking session or a formal business dinner, waterfront venues create an unparalleled experience that fosters engagement and relaxation.
7. Vineyard and Winery Venues
Vineyard and winery venues offer a charming and picturesque setting that is ideal for corporate events focused on relaxation, networking, and team-building. These venues provide a mix of rustic charm and luxury, featuring beautiful landscapes, elegant tasting rooms, and world-class wines.
Regions such as Napa Valley, California; Tuscany, Italy; and Bordeaux, France are home to some of the most breathtaking vineyards that cater to corporate gatherings. Attendees can indulge in wine tastings, gourmet farm-to-table meals, and scenic outdoor seating areas perfect for discussions and brainstorming sessions. Vineyard venues also allow companies to incorporate unique activities such as grape harvesting experiences, blending workshops, and sommelier-led tours. If you’re looking for a serene escape from traditional corporate settings, a vineyard venue can offer an immersive and relaxing experience for your guests.
Conclusion
Selecting the right venue for a corporate event goes beyond just finding a location—it plays a pivotal role in shaping the overall experience and success of the gathering. A well-chosen venue can create a lasting impression on attendees, foster meaningful interactions, and enhance your brand’s image. Whether your goal is to host an elegant gala, an innovative product launch, a high-energy networking session, or a strategic business meeting, the venue sets the stage for achieving these objectives.
When choosing a corporate event venue, it is essential to consider key factors such as the type of event, the number of attendees, accessibility, and the desired ambiance. A luxurious hotel offers sophistication and high-end amenities, making it ideal for executive meetings and formal conferences. Historic estates or cultural landmarks add a touch of prestige and uniqueness, creating an unforgettable atmosphere for clients and partners. On the other hand, modern co-working spaces and high-tech conference centers cater to businesses that prioritize innovation, collaboration, and seamless digital integration.
Beyond aesthetics and functionality, a carefully selected venue can drive tangible business benefits. It provides an opportunity to strengthen brand visibility, enhance networking opportunities, and leave a lasting impact on stakeholders. By aligning the venue choice with your company’s goals and values, you can create an event that is not only enjoyable but also strategically beneficial for business growth.
Ultimately, the right venue transforms an ordinary event into an extraordinary experience. Whether you opt for a grand ballroom, an intimate retreat, or a cutting-edge tech hub, your choice will set the tone for engagement, inspiration, and success. Take the time to assess your needs, explore various options, and invest in a venue that will elevate your corporate event to new heights.
FAQs
1. What factors should I consider when choosing a corporate event venue? Consider location, capacity, amenities, technology, budget, and the overall atmosphere that aligns with your event’s goals.
2. How far in advance should I book a venue for a corporate event? It’s best to book at least six months in advance to secure availability, especially for popular venues.
3. Are outdoor venues a good choice for corporate events? Yes, outdoor venues like rooftop spaces, vineyards, and waterfront locations provide a unique ambiance, but always have a backup plan in case of weather changes.
4. Do corporate event venues provide catering services? Many venues offer in-house catering, but you can also explore external catering services based on your event’s theme and dietary preferences.
5. Can I host a hybrid corporate event at these venues? Yes, many modern venues offer hybrid event capabilities with high-speed internet, live-streaming options, and tech support for virtual attendees.

A subject matter expert in facilities, workplace, culture, tech, and SaaS, I create impactful content strategies that enhance startup retention and foster strong connections. With a blend of technical expertise and creativity, I drive engagement and loyalty. Always eager for challenges and make a lasting impact.